Разделение строки с помощью IFS

sudo apt-get install xclip

Создайте псевдоним:

 alias pbcopy='xclip -selection clipboard'

Используйте эту команду, чтобы скопировать

ls | pbcopy

(Вы также можете использовать

ls  | pbcopy 

, чтобы скопировать конкретное имя файла. Если вы не знаете, что такое псевдоним: http://www.hostingadvice.com/how-to/set-command-aliases-linuxubuntudebian/ )

8
11.10.2017, 12:58
1 ответ

Часто можно поместить разбиение строки в подоболочку. Если это так, это решает проблему правильного восстановления настроек noglob или IFS.

a="world-thing-hello"
t="$(set -o noglob; IFS=-; set -- $a; echo $2)"
echo "This is the $t."

Вот в чем дело.

0
13.02.2021, 18:07

Теги

Похожие вопросы